Watch: Ozil bags breakthrough in tight clash vs. Italy
Regis Duvignau / Reuters
Germany was gaining some momentum in the second stanza of a tight and tactical quarter-final tilt with Italy on Saturday, and it was rewarded when Mesut Ozil gave his side the advantage on 65 minutes.
Die Mannschaft was making inroads down the left in particular, and the Arsenal man made no mistake when he connected with Jonas Hector's deflected cross.
